摘要
The next generation in manufacturing systems requires flexible, intelligent and reconfigurable systems due to personalized product trends. The problem resides in that the manufacturing area and the process reconfigurability is restricted by the matrix rigidity and the manufacture and design protocol, said protocols do not allow reconfiguarability to have a technological development. A wide variety of metal-mechanical industry products are manufactured by metal forging or hot-molding processes. However, despite all technological developments achieved in said field, manufacturing times are still longer and costs for manufacturing dies more expensive, thus the possibility of having a reconfigurable die is attractive since it would provide the opportunity of manufacturing different products at a low cost and in a reduced time as dies may last weeks or months to be manufactured, on the other hand a reconfigurable die may allow a different geometry to be obtained in minutes or hours. The pr esent invention describes a reconfigurable system for shaping materials by computer in a controlled manner including a higher bolt density per area unit for increasing the amount of parts to be produced and reducing costs and times of pieces for the manufacturing industry. The inventive system avoids manufacturing a different die each time the geometry of a product to be manufactured is changed. The use of the memory effect material as an actuator in the reconfigurability mechanism is the key to the success of the reconfigurable system and the control system owing to the permissibility of small bolts which can be adapted to standard sizes and shapes. The invention also includes eight claims referring to the mechatronic system and the method for shaping materials by means of a die having a reconfigurable surface using memory effect actuators.
